‘Watchmen’ headlines honors at Television Critics Association’s Awards

The amazing “Watchmen” from HBO, was the big winner in the 36th Annual Television Critics Association’s Awards Awards (TCA Awards), it was announced today.

The drama was inspired by a legendary graphic novel and with commentary about our real-world racial reckoning, and won four awards, in the 2019-20 TV season. Those awards included Program of the Year and Individual Achievement in Drama, which was awarded to Oscar and Emmy winner Regina King. 

‘Watchmen’ had many viewers to the Tulsa race massacre which also triumphed in the new program and shows, attending to HBO’s overall haul of six TCA Awards. 

The Drama — written and produced by Damon Dindelof — has 26 nominations going into Sunday’s Primetime Emmy Awards.

Other programs recognized included HBO’s “Succession,” ESPN’s “The Last Dance” and Pop TV’s “Schitt’s Creek.” Two entertainment legends, “Jeopardy!” host Alex Trebek and the original “Star Trek” TV series, also received honors.

The Winners were elected by the vote of TCA members, a group of more than 250 TV critics and journalists from the U.S. and Canada. 

Some of the prizes that achieved: 

Individual Achievement In Drama: Regina King (“Watchmen,” HBO)

Individual Achievement In Comedy: Catherine O’Hara (“Schitt’s Creek,” Pop TV)

● Outstanding Achievement In News and Information: “The Last Dance” (ESPN)

● Outstanding Achievement In Reality Programming: “Cheer” (Netflix)

● Outstanding Achievement In Youth Programming: “Molly of Denali” (PBS Kids)

● Outstanding Achievement In Sketch/Variety Shows: “A Black Lady Sketch Show” (HBO)

● Outstanding New Program: “Watchmen” (HBO)

● Outstanding Achievement In Movie, Miniseries, Or Special: “Watchmen” (HBO)

● Outstanding Achievement In Drama:“Succession” (HBO)

● Outstanding Achievement In Comedy: “Schitt’s Creek” (Pop TV)

● Program of the Year: “Watchmen” (HBO)

● Career Achievement Honoree: Alex Trebek

● Heritage Award: “Star Trek” (CBS)
